Newer versions of Android should show which app installed an app in each app info screen.

See an example screenshot at the bottom:

That is possible, but if an app is installed by package manager, you won’t know which app asked to install it. In your case, you know that it’s installed from “F-Droid Privileged Extension” but if it is a
common install from e.g. the file explorer, you won’t know where it is. Therefore, don’t press “install” an app if you don’t know the source when the prompt pops up.
And on top of that, only give “install unknown apps” permission to apps you trust, e.g. F-Droid.

I checked all of those apps and they are all on F-Droid with one thing in common: they are all old from 2017, 2015 and 2016 respectively. You can install App Manager to see when it was installed because it seems to me that you just pressed the wrong button when scrolling through F-Droid.
